форум общения русскоязычных пользователей CMS Текстпаттерн
Вы не зашли.
Все нормально установилось. Отсутствие и наличие файла .htaccess на ошибку никак не влияют.
В логе вот что : [Thu Jun 07 16:15:00 2007] [error] [client х.х.х.х] Premature end of script headers: php-script.
Неактивен
Снес что? Установка же это банальная разархивация и создание конфига, который потом записывается в папку.
Что сносить то?
Неактивен
Похожая история... заглавная страница доступна по _www.bla-bla-bla.ru/index.php, но по _www.bla-bla-bla.ru выдает:
Internal Server Error
The server encountered an internal error or misconfiguration and was unable to complete your request.
Please contact the server administrator, you@example.com and inform them of the time the error occurred, and anything you might have done that may have caused the error.
More information about this error may be available in the server error log
mod_dir и mod_rewrite работают исправно...
И всё бы ничего, но при переходе между разделами выдается такая же ошибка...
add: нашел в другой теме - ссылаются на неисправность mod_rewrite, но такая ошибка, как я понял, уже у большого колличества людей
Отредактированно xazel (08-06-2007 12:12:30)
Неактивен
sa написал:
Снес что? Установка же это банальная разархивация и создание конфига, который потом записывается в папку.
Что сносить то?
потереть все в папке, потереть таблицы в базе... стоп, стоп. А ты setup-то запускал?
Неактивен
glebotr, дело в данном случае не в сетапе, а в том что по какой то причине не проходит clean_url_test. Ниже по темам этот вопрос, как я понял, обсасывался неоднократно и люди даже, вроде как находили ответы на него, но не один из них не подходит к, например, моей ситуации: у меня разкоментирован LoadModule Rewrite_module, стоит для всех vhost'ов AllowOverride All, phpinfo(); прекрасно показывает что mod_rewrite включен... вообщем, теряюсь в догадках...
Add: временно решил проблему удалением .htaccess и установкой режима постоянных ссылок на ?=messy, но как постоянное решение - не катит...
Отредактированно xazel (08-06-2007 17:59:39)
Неактивен
вчера была такая проблема: при установке TxP-Фирма на новый (неизвестный) хостинг получил 500 ошибку. Устранилось удалением последней строки в .htaccess
php_value register_globals 0
но можно было и закомментировать
Неактивен
спасибо за информацию, но не помогает... похоже, единственный выход пока это убить чистые урлы впринципе
Отредактированно xazel (09-06-2007 08:59:25)
Неактивен
все заработало... На папке, в которую ставится скрипт должно быть 755. Не больше не меньше.
Неактивен
755 для какого пользователя? Очень сомнительно, что разрешение на запись должно предоставляться пользователю от имени которого запускается апач. А вообще пермишены должны автоматически для папок создаваться. Если это было на хостинге, то нужно подумать о своём будущем.
Неактивен
Очень долго мучался, потом все устранилось удалением последней строки в .htaccess TNX
Неактивен
Я сегодня сталкнулся с похожим приптствием неработают ссылки ну и всё как выше описано
удалял последнюю строчу в файле .htaccess и никаких изменений а если вообще удалить .htaccess тогда всё летает возможно проблема кроется в моей панели управления хостингом у меня ISP панель если ктонибудь сталкивался с похожей задачей прошу помогите разобраться
Отредактированно Dekster (25-10-2009 07:09:14)
Неактивен
1. Ставьте запятые
2. http://textpattern.com/faq/52/500-internal-server-error
3. http://textpattern.com/faq/104/404-erro … e-indexphp
Неактивен
Дело в сё в том что у меня сайт стоит на поддомене и как настроить .htaccess для коректной работы я незнаю
при открытии индексной страницы сайта ( http://под.домен.ru ) = Internal Server Error
а если набираю ( http://под.домен.ru/index.php ) то попадаю на главную страницу сайта при этом навигация по сайту неработает ,но если удаляю .htaccess то всё работает нормально в том числе и навигация .Если кому несложно посоветуйте варианты содержимого .htaccess
вот моё содержимое .htaccess
//////////////////////////////////////////////////
#DirectoryIndex index.php index.html
#Options +FollowSymLinks
#RewriteBase /relative/web/path/
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} -f [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ule ^(.+) - [PT,L]
RewriteRule ^(.*) index.php
</IfModule>
php_value register_globals 0
//////////////////////////////////////////////////
перепробовал всё что тут на форуме описывалось непомогло обратился в поддержку хостинга там специалисты сказали что нужно искать ответ на форуме посвящёному данной Cms. Прошу вас откликнитесь светлые умы нашего времени!!
Неактивен
Если удаляю эти строчки то всё работает может тут как то надо подправлять или в чём ещё дело может быть?
///////////////////////////////////////////////////////
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} -f [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ule ^(.+) - [PT,L]
RewriteRule ^(.*) index.php
</IfModule>
////////////////////////////////////////////////////
В чём может таиться заморочка? или неподдерживается mod_rewrite или нужно в .htaccess копаться
Отредактированно Dekster (28-10-2009 06:43:29)
Неактивен
раскомментировать строчку
RewriteBase /relative/web/path/ и указать название подпапки, в которую засунули текстпаттерн - обычно помогает.
Неактивен
the_ghost написал:
раскомментировать строчку
RewriteBase /relative/web/path/ и указать название подпапки, в которую засунули текстпаттерн - обычно помогает.
Спасибо тебе дружище ты здорово мне помог советом я прям так и сделал я .htaccess в архив добавил и теперь он там на хостинге лежит в архиве и всё работает
Неактивен
Конкретно дело всё обстояло в следующем на апаче существует иерархия как мне объяснил програмист , а у меня как я говорил сайт находится на поддомене а содержимое .htaccess непредусматривало установку на поддомен и mod_rewrite который прописан тут попросту неработает так как в папке выше уровнем уже прописаны правила для этой функции ,а следовательно эти строчки :
////////////////////////////////////////////////////////////
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} -f [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ule ^(.+) - [PT,L]
RewriteRule ^(.*) index.php
</IfModule>
/////////////////////////////////////////////////////////// можно смело удалять! и всё чпу будет работать должным образом ...
Неактивен